Developing new, healthier routines can fill the void left by addiction. Regular exercise, balanced meals, and sufficient sleep are fundamental to your physical and mental health. Practices such as mindfulness, yoga, or keeping a journal can alleviate stress and control emotions that lead to cravings. Participating in hobbies or acquiring new abilities can steer your attention toward rewarding and meaningful endeavors.

Establishing practical objectives ensures you remain motivated throughout your recovery. Dividing your recovery into small, manageable actions reduces feelings of being overwhelmed. Acknowledging achievements, like maintaining sobriety for a specific time, can boost your morale. Such successes strengthen your resolve and emphasize the strides you have taken.
Staying mindful of triggers is crucial. Some environments, individuals, or scenarios might encourage you to fall back into addiction. Understanding these challenges enables you to proactively steer clear of them. In cases where avoidance is impractical, implementing a response strategy can protect your progress.
